You need to know what each term means and how it is defined before you can tell them apart.
Generally speaking, fiat currency refers to a form of legal cash that is backed by a national government and is exchanged directly between individuals. Money in the United States, the United Kingdom, the Eurozone, etc. Contrarily, crypto money is not recognized as legal tender and is not backed by any national government or central bank.
As a result, it is important to distinguish between crypto currency and fiat currency in the following ways:
Cryptocurrencies, by their very nature, are decentralized and international in scope. Neither a central bank nor any government has legal authority over the money. Fiat money is governed by government and bank restrictions.
Cryptocurrencies live solely in the virtual world. Contrarily, you’ll find that fiat currencies exist in the real world.
The market can only absorb a certain number of cryptos at a time. In contrast, there is no limit to the quantity of fiat currency because the government and the central bank can print as much of it as they see necessary at any one time.
Whereas governments and banks issue fiat money, c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in are generated entirely digitally.

Here’s a look at the two currencies side-by-side:
• The Chinese Song dynasty of the 11th century was reportedly the first to print paper money. Money of greater value, such as gold, silver, or silk, was not permitted in trade.
• Tally sticks were issued by the government as a form of fiat currency. For the purpose of making up for gold shortfalls, 1100 Tally sticks were implemented.
1971 was the year that the concept of fiat currency was officially recognized all across the world. The goal of its introduction by President Nixon was to free the dollar from its link to gold.
• Wei Dai first proposed the concept of an anonymous electronic cash system in 1998. Nick Szabo introduced the world to the concept of crypto currencies with Bitgold, but it was largely forgotten in favor of Bitcoin.
The first decentralized digital money to achieve widespread acceptance was Bitcoin, which was released to the public in 2009. Several other crypto currencies appeared in 2011 and later. Litecoin, Dogecoin, Ethereum, Ripple, Zcash, Dash, and so on are only some of the most well-known examples.
